SynchronizedList.java
package eu.javaexperience.collection.list;
import java.util.Collection;
import java.util.Iterator;
import java.util.List;
import java.util.ListIterator;
public class SynchronizedList<E> implements List<E>
{
protected List<E> list;
public SynchronizedList(List<E> lst)
{
this.list = lst;
}
@Override
public synchronized int size()
{
return list.size();
}
@Override
public synchronized boolean isEmpty()
{
return list.isEmpty();
}
@Override
public synchronized boolean contains(Object o)
{
return list.contains(o);
}
@Override
public synchronized Iterator<E> iterator()
{
return list.iterator();
}
@Override
public synchronized Object[] toArray()
{
return list.toArray();
}
@Override
public synchronized <T> T[] toArray(T[] a)
{
return list.toArray(a);
}
@Override
public synchronized boolean add(E e)
{
return list.add(e);
}
@Override
public synchronized boolean remove(Object o)
{
return list.remove(o);
}
@Override
public synchronized boolean containsAll(Collection<?> c)
{
return list.containsAll(c);
}
@Override
public synchronized boolean addAll(Collection<? extends E> c)
{
return list.addAll(c);
}
@Override
public synchronized boolean addAll(int index, Collection<? extends E> c)
{
return list.addAll(index, c);
}
@Override
public synchronized boolean removeAll(Collection<?> c)
{
return list.removeAll(c);
}
@Override
public synchronized boolean retainAll(Collection<?> c)
{
return list.retainAll(c);
}
@Override
public synchronized void clear()
{
list.clear();
}
@Override
public synchronized E get(int index)
{
return list.get(index);
}
@Override
public synchronized E set(int index, E element)
{
return list.set(index, element);
}
@Override
public synchronized void add(int index, E element)
{
list.add(index, element);
}
@Override
public synchronized E remove(int index)
{
return list.remove(index);
}
@Override
public synchronized int indexOf(Object o)
{
return list.indexOf(o);
}
@Override
public synchronized int lastIndexOf(Object o)
{
return list.lastIndexOf(o);
}
@Override
public synchronized ListIterator<E> listIterator()
{
return list.listIterator();
}
@Override
public synchronized ListIterator<E> listIterator(int index)
{
return list.listIterator(index);
}
@Override
public synchronized List<E> subList(int fromIndex, int toIndex)
{
return list.subList(fromIndex, toIndex);
}
}
